Core Skills Analysis
Performing Arts
- Students learned the basics of juggling as a form of performance, enhancing hand-eye coordination.
- They explored different acting techniques by portraying characters in circus acts, improving their expressiveness.
- Teamwork and collaboration were emphasized through group performances, teaching them the importance of working together.
- Students developed confidence by performing in front of their peers, which is crucial for any performing art.
Mathematics
- Understanding the concept of symmetry and balance while performing tricks, such as balancing acts.
- Students learned to use counting and timing while performing routines, which involves rhythm and beat counting.
- They practiced geometry concepts through the shapes formed in various circus acts, enhancing spatial awareness.
- Measurement was applied when estimating distances for jumps or throws, reinforcing estimation skills.
Physical Education
- Pupils engaged in physical movement that improved their overall fitness levels and endurance.
- They learned about body control and agility through various circus activities such as acrobatics and tightrope walking.
- Circus skills like clowning require physical comedy, enhancing their creativity and adaptation to movement.
- The activity helped in developing flexibility and strength, beneficial for overall physical health.
